Since it was published at peak holiday season, I'm taking the liberty to re-introduce our recent review article. We hope it will be a useful overview of RNA virus replication strategies, and how in situ cryo-EM have helped us understand them:
www.sciencedirect.com/science/arti...
Illuminating druggable dark matter in RNA virus replication using in situ cryo-EM
Viral proteins typically exist in the context of complex virions or in the even more complex host cells in which they replicate. Hence, meaningful ins…

Our aim was to create a kit to produce in-house 1.2 holey carbon cryoEM grids, in three simple steps, at less than half of the prize, and without due times. I think we are there. Academic teams that want to know more, receive training or order a kit, please contact [email protected].
